Biography of The Lost Boys Cast
The Lost Boys features a range of actors who brought their unique flair to the film. Below is a table outlining some key cast members along with their personal details.
Name | Role | Birthdate | Notable Works |
---|---|---|---|
Jason Patric | Michael Emerson | June 17, 1966 | Speed 2, The Alamo |
Corey Haim | Sam Emerson | April 23, 1971 | The Goonies, License to Drive |
Corey Feldman | Edgar Frog | July 16, 1971 | The Goonies, Stand By Me |
Kiefer Sutherland | David | December 21, 1966 | 24, Designated Survivor |
Dianne Wiest | Lucy Emerson | March 28, 1946 | Hannah and Her Sisters, Bullets Over Broadway |
Core Cast Members
Jason Patric as Michael Emerson
Jason Patric plays the lead role of Michael Emerson, a teenager who moves to Santa Carla with his family. As Michael becomes entangled with a group of vampires, his struggle between his humanity and the allure of immortality forms the crux of the film. Patric's performance is both compelling and relatable, capturing the essence of a young man facing the challenges of life and love.
Corey Haim as Sam Emerson
Corey Haim captures the spirit of youthful innocence as Sam Emerson, Michael's younger brother. Haim's charm and humor provide a counterbalance to the darker themes of the movie. His character's journey from fear to bravery resonates with audiences, making him a beloved figure in the film.
Corey Feldman as Edgar Frog
Corey Feldman portrays the witty and resourceful vampire hunter Edgar Frog. Feldman's performance is a standout, bringing a unique blend of humor and bravado to the character. Edgar Frog has since become an iconic figure in vampire lore, symbolizing the fight against evil.
Kiefer Sutherland as David
Kiefer Sutherland's portrayal of David, the charismatic leader of the vampire gang, is one of the film's highlights. His brooding demeanor and magnetic presence create an alluring yet menacing character that captivates viewers. Sutherland's performance has earned him recognition as one of the film's most memorable villains.
Supporting Cast Members
Dianne Wiest as Lucy Emerson
Dianne Wiest plays Lucy Emerson, the mother of Michael and Sam. Wiest's performance adds emotional depth to the film, showcasing the challenges of a single mother trying to protect her children amidst supernatural chaos. Her character's journey is relatable and poignant.
Other Notable Cast Members
In addition to the main cast, The Lost Boys features a variety of supporting actors who contribute to the film's rich narrative. These include:
- Edward Herrmann as Max
- Jamison Newlander as Alan Frog
- Bernard D. O'Connell as the Town Sheriff

Career Paths After The Lost Boys
Following the success of The Lost Boys, many cast members continued to have fruitful careers in film and television. Kiefer Sutherland found success in television with shows like "24" and "Designated Survivor," while Corey Feldman became a prominent figure in pop culture, known for both his acting and music career.
